当前位置:文档之家› TMS320F28027课件_第一讲_绪论

TMS320F28027课件_第一讲_绪论

低功耗16位定点DSP。两个子系列:C54x和C55x。该系列DSP待机功率小于0.15mW ,工作功率小于0.15mW/MHz,是业界功耗最低的16位DSP,主要用于语音处理、移动 通信、医疗监测等便携设备。
3、TMS320C2000系列---强控制
不但具有DSP内核,而且还具有用于电机控制的片上外设,从而将高速运算与灵 活控制融于一体。主要用于电机控制、数字电源和再生能源、电动汽车及LED照明等 领域。该系列产品目前仍有119种在生产。由于该系列DSP主要用于控制领域,TI公司 又将该系列DSP芯片归类为DSC(即数字信号控制器),习惯仍称其为DSP。
SARAM:M0-1KW、M1-1KW、L0SARAM-4KW
Boot ROM:8KW OPT存储器:1KW
八、28027芯片功能 4、PIE 支持多达96 个外设中断,分成8 组 F2802x使用33个
可以通过硬件和软件控制中断的优先级
可以在PIE 内启用/禁用每个中断 支持3 个可屏蔽外部中断
八、28027芯片功能 6、 Peripheral Device 增强型脉宽调制器(ePWM) 高分辨率PWM (HRPWM)
增强型捕捉(eCAP)
模数转换器(ADC) (片上温度传感器) 比较器(COMP) 串行接口外设(SPI、SCI、I2C)
九、内存映射 程序空间(Prog Space) –保存程序代码及常量 –掉电不丢失 数据空间(Data Space) –保存寄存器及临时变量值 –掉电丢失
八、28027芯片功能 5、CLOCK 两个内部零引脚振荡器(INTOSC1、INTOSC2) 外部时钟源
PLL 支持高达12 个输入时钟缩放比
外设的时钟可被启用/禁用以减少功耗 32 位CPU 定时器(Timer0,Timer1,Timer2) 看门狗WatchDog
八、28027芯片功能 5、CLOCK 低功耗运行
4、 BOOT ROM – 8KW 上电引导程序区 向量表(32个向量)
教材与软硬件
• 硬件:
仿真器
开发板
口袋实验板
教材与软硬件
口袋实验板电路图
课堂授课时间分配: (32学时)
Lecture1 Introduction-----------------2Class Lecture2 PIE----------------------------2Class
Lecture3 GPIO-------------------------4Class
九、内存映射 1、 SARAM – 6KW
M0,1KW –向量表 M1,1KW –常作为堆栈
常配置为Data L0,4KW –双重映射 配置为Data或Prog
九、内存映射 2、 FLASH – 32KW
程序写入该存储器,受CSM保护, 防止非法读取。
九、内存映射 3、 OTP – 1KW 使用较少
Lecture8 eCAP -------------------------2Class
Lecture9 Application -----------------2Class Experiment -----------------------------4Class
期末成绩评定
• 期末考试: 80% • 上机实验: 10% • 考勤和作业: 10%
n
•幅值上连续 •时间上连续
11
•幅值上量化 •时间上离散
2015-3-31
二、模拟(Analog )与数字(Digital)信号 模拟信号处理
W1 R2 + R1 A1 R5 R7 + A3 C + A2 R6 R8
-
x(t )
W2
R3 R4
-
y (t )
-
y (t ) K P x (t ) K I
三、DSP芯片分类 2、按数据格式分
– 定点 DSP
数据以定点格式工作的 DSP芯片称为定点 DSP芯 片,该芯片简单、成本较低。两种基本表示方法: • 整数表示方法: 主要用于控制操作、地址计算 和其他非信号处理的应用。 • 小数表示方法:主要用于数字和各种信号处理算 法的计算中。定点表示并不意味着一定是整数表示。
七、2802x系列概述 – 代码安全模块,128位密码保护,防止固件逆向工程
– 增强型控制外设:增强型脉宽调制器(ePWM)、高分辨
率PWM (HRPWM)、增强型捕捉(eCAP)、模数转换 器(ADC)、片上温度传感器、比较器、通信外设 (SCI、I2C、SPI) – 16 x 16 和32 x 32 媒介访问控制(MAC) 运算
数字信号处理与模拟信号处理的特点比较
比较内容 数字处理 模拟处理
灵活性
可靠性 精 度

高 高 差

差 差 好
实时性
2015-3-31
13
三、DSP芯片分类 1、按用途分类
– 通用型DSP芯片
一般指可以用指令编程的 DSP 芯片,适合普通的 DSP 应 用,如TI公司的一系列DSP芯片属于通用型DSP芯片。 – 专用型DSP芯片 为特定的 DSP运算而设计,如数字滤波、卷积和 FFT 等, 通过加载数据、控制参数或在管脚上加控制信号的方 法使其 具 有有限 的 可编程 能 力 。如 Motorola 公 司 的 DSP56200(FIR数字滤波)。
• 第三代:TMS320C30/C31/C32, • 第四代:TMS320C40/C44, • 第五代:TMS320C50/C51/C52/C53/C54和集多个 DSP于一体的高性能DSP芯片TMS320C80/C82等 • 第六代:TMS320C62x/C67x等,代表DSP顶尖水平
五、TI公司DSP芯片发展 1、TMS320C6000系列---高性能
三、DSP芯片分类 2、按数据格式分 – 浮点 DSP 数据以浮点格式工作的DSP芯片称为浮点DSP芯片,
该芯片运算精度高、运行速度快。
浮点数在运算中,表示数的范围由于其指数可自动
调节,因此可避免数的规格化和溢出等问题。但浮点
DSP一般比定点DSP复杂,成本较高。
四、DSP芯片发展 ☉1978年第一片DSP诞生S2811 (Microsystems公司AMI子
Lecture1 Introduction 一、DSP与DSP技术 ☉DSP(Digital Signal Processing)----数字信号处理
的理论和方法。
☉DSP(Digital Signal Processor)----用于数字信号处 理的可编程微处理器。 ☉DSP技术(Digital Signal Process)----是利用专门或 通用数字信号处理芯片,通过数字计算的方法对信号
Lecture4 SCI ---------------------------2Class Lecture5 ADC--------------------------4Class Lecture6 PWM-------------------------8Class Lecture7 HRPWM --------------------2Class
2015-3-31
20
七、2802x系列概述
TMS320F28027、 TMS320F28026、 TMS320F28023、 TMS320F28022、 TMS320F28021、 TMS320F28020、 TMS320F280200、
七、2802x系列概述
七、2802x系列概述 – 高效32 位中央处理单元(CPU)
公司)
☉1986年以来得到突飞猛进的发展。 ☉现今主要 DSP 芯片生产商:德州仪器公司( TI) 、美国 模拟器件公司(ADI) 、Motorola公司、Freescale、ARM、 MIPS ;
五、TI公司DSP芯片发展 • 第一代:TMS32010及其系列产品(1982年)
• 第二代:TMS320C20、TMS320C25/C26/C28
PROTEUS V8.1
教材与软硬件
调试窗口
变量,观察,寄存 器口
程序窗口
控制台窗口
CCS V5.5
教材与软硬件
PROTUES V8.1
教材与软硬件CCS5.5 云盘下载地址 /s/1dDEiXxf
protues 8.1云盘下载地址 /s/1bn2HG1x
目前有9种芯片。典型产品: •F28335:32位浮点,150MHz,256KW Flash,34KW ram,16ch ADC,增强电机控制接口…
4、 Concerto(协奏曲)--多核型
将ARM Cortex-M3内核与C28x内核结合到一个芯片上,实现了连接和控制一体化。同 时还可以将通信和控制分开设计。该系列目前有34种芯片供选择。
– 3.3V 单电源供电
– 高速60MHz(16.67ns),50MHz,和40MHz

PLL锁相环技术
– 集成型上电和欠压复位 – 两个内部零引脚振荡器
– 多达22 个复用通用输入/出(GPIO) 引脚,输入尖脉冲滤波
– 三个32 位CPU 定时器 – 片载闪存、SRAM、一次性可编程(OTP) 内存、引导ROM
– 16 x 16 双MAC
– 哈佛(Harvard) 总线架构 –可支持所有外设中断的外设中断扩展(PIE) 模块
八、28027芯片功能 CPU BUS JTAG
MEMORY
PIE CLOCK GPIO Peripheral Device
八、28027芯片功能 1、CPU 32 位定点架构 高效的C/C++ 引擎
教材:《32位数字信号控制器原理及应用》
《DSP原理及应用》
Lecture1 Introduction
黄灿水 2015.3
教材与软硬件 • 教材:
相关主题